Agatha Christie #1

It is interesting that in And Then There Were None one person kills ten people and himself.

In Murder On The Orient Express twelve people (the number of people on a jury) stab and kill one person.

And Then There Were None (also known as Ten Little Indians) takes place on an island off the Devon Coast in Southern England, as does the P.D. James novel The Lighthouse.
